You will now see a small check mark at the extreme right of the
sample name indicating that this sample has been assigned and
is now ready to be saved.
Now you can press STORE and select a destination and a name
for your new sound.
As mentioned before, you may save this sound into any availa-
ble location in the user sound families. Press ENTER to com-
plete the operation.
Assigning multiple samples
If you have loaded a number of different samples into SAMPLE
TRANSLATOR then you will need to use the ASSIGN MENU to
map your samples to specific areas of the keyboard.
Place the cursor over each sample and press the INCLUDE but-
ton, (F3). Now you will see an upper and lower note limit of A0 to
C8 for the selected sample. Place the cursor over the A0.
You can change this value either with the dial or, if you press the
MIDI button, (F2), you can change it by pressing a key on the
keyboard. Once you've assigned the lower note limit, move the
cursor to the upper note and assign this in the same way. This
process should be repeated for every sample in the list.
